沈 阳 工 程 学 院
课 程 设 计
设计题目: 简易交通灯控制系统
系 别 自动化学院 班级 电子本111 学生姓名 滕希超 学号 2011312121 指导教师 田景贺 职称 讲师 起止日期: 2013年12 月 23日起——至 2013年 12 月27日止
沈阳工程学院
课程设计任务书
课程设计题目: 简易交通灯控制系统
系 别 自动化学院 班级 电子本111 学生姓名 滕希超 学号 2011312121 指导教师 田景贺 职称 讲师 课程设计进行地点: 实训F215 任 务 下 达 时 间: 2013 年 12 月 20 日 起止日期: 2013年12月23日起——至 2013年12月27日止
教研室主任 田景贺 2013年 12月 16日批准
沈 阳 工 程 学 院
2
数字电子课程设计成绩评定表
系(部): 自动化学院 班级: 电子本111 学生姓名: 滕希超
指 导 教 师 评 审 意 见 评价 内容 具 体 要 求 权重 0.1 5 评 分 4 3 2 加权分 调研 能独立查阅文献,收集资料;能制定课程设计方案论证 和日程安排。 工作工作态度认真,遵守纪律,出勤情况是否良好,能能力 够独立完成设计工作, 态度 工作量 按期圆满完成规定的设计任务,工作量饱满,难度适宜。 0.2 5 4 3 2 0.2 5 4 3 2 说明说明书立论正确,论述充分,结论严谨合理,文字书的通顺,技术用语准确,符号统一,编号齐全,图表质量 完备,书写工整规范。 0.5 5 4 3 2 指导教师评审成绩 (加权分合计乘以12) 指 导 教 师 签 名: 分 加权分合计 年 月 日 评 阅 教 师 评 审 意 见 评价 内容 查阅 文献 工作量 具 体 要 求 查阅文献有一定广泛性;有综合归纳资料的能力 工作量饱满,难度适中。 权重 0.2 0.5 评 分 加权分 5 5 5 4 4 4 3 3 3 2 2 2 说明说明书立论正确,论述充分,结论严谨合理,文字书的通顺,技术用语准确,符号统一,编号齐全,图表质量 完备,书写工整规范。 0.3 评阅教师评审成绩 (加权分合计乘以8) 评 阅 教 师 签 名: 课 程 设 计 总 评 成 绩 分 加权分合计 年 月 日 分 中文摘要
本次数字电路毕业设计内容是设计交通灯控制器。该系统的基本功能为:在
3
东西南北方向行驶的车辆通过十字路口,在十字路中正中,每条道路各有一组红,黄,绿灯和倒计时显示器,用以指挥车辆和行人有序的通行。其中,红灯亮表示该道路禁止通行;黄灯亮表示停车;绿灯亮表示可以通行;倒计时显示器是用来显示允许通行或禁止通行的时间。交通灯控制器就是用于自动控制十字路口的交通灯和计时器,指挥各种车辆和行人的安全通行。
简易交通灯设计电路主要芯片有74LS138,74LS192,NE555,74LS48,以定时器NE555构成的多谐振荡器用以产生周期为1秒脉冲波形,用于被74LS192计数,同时用两块74LS192芯片通过级联的方式构成60进制倒数计时器,将倒数计时器输出的数据传入两块74LS48译码器里,74LS192中读取的数值最终通过两块七段数码管显示出来。计时的部分由两块倒计时器74LS192与若干个逻辑门共同构成,工作过程共分为四个阶段每个阶段经历的时间分别为55秒,5秒,55秒和5秒,在每隔55秒或5秒输出一个脉冲,通过下降沿触发状态控制器工作。使状态转变,并通过地址译码器74LS138控制着信号灯的转换。其中红灯亮的时间为55秒,黄灯为5秒,绿灯为55秒。
关键词:交通灯, 脉冲信号,倒数计时器,控制器,译码器。
目录
4
课程设计任务书...................................................... 2 数字电子课程设计成绩评定表.......................................... 3 中 文 摘 要......................................................... 4 1 设计任务描述...................................................... 6
1.1设计题目:简易交通灯控制系统................................. 6 1.2 设计要求 .................................................... 6 1.2.1 设计目的.................................................. 6 1.2.2 基本要求.................................................. 6 1.2.3 发挥部分.................................................. 6 2 各部分电路设计.................................................... 6
2.1 秒脉冲电路的设计............................................ 6 2.2倒数计时器 .................................................. 7 2.3时间显示器 .................................................. 7 2.4 定时器 状态控制器........................................... 8 2.5信号灯显示 .................................................. 9 2.6总电路设计 ................................................. 10 3 元器件清单....................................................... 11 参考文献......................................................... 11
1. 设计任务描述
5
1.1设计题目:简易交通灯控制系统
1.2设计目的:
(1)能独立查阅、整理、分析有关资料
(2)能用数字集成电路完成设计任务 (3)掌握脉冲产生、整形与分频电路
(4)掌握计数、译码与显示电路
1.3基本要求:
(1) 模拟东西南北两路交通指示灯
(2) 红灯亮60秒,黄灯亮5秒,绿灯亮55秒
1.3发挥部分:有能力的同学可以利用课余时间进行电路焊接及调试。
2. 各部分电路设计及参数计算
2.1 秒脉冲电路的设计
系统所需要的秒脉冲由定时器NE555所构成的多谐振荡器提供,多谐振荡器如图1—1(a)所示,图中NE555外引线排列如图1—1(b)所示。其中1脚是电路地GND;8脚是正电源端Ucc,工作电压范围为5~18V;2脚是低触发端TR;3脚是输出端OUT;4脚是主复位端R;5脚是控制电压端Uc;6脚是高触发端TH;7脚放电端DISC。R1、R2和C为定时电阻和电容,C1为电压控制端稳定电容。在信号的输出端产生矩形脉冲,其振荡频率为 f=1.44/( R1+2R2)C 。
8R17GND13R26C2TROUTR15C1234456UccDISC7TH8UcNE555NE555
6
2.2 倒数计时器
倒计时器由两位4位十进制可逆同步计数器(双时钟)74LS192、一个非门和一或门构成。其组成如图2—1(a)所示,其中 74LS192是上升沿触发,CPU为加计数时钟输入端;CPD为减计数时钟输入端;LD为异步预置端,低有效;CR为异步清零端,高有效;CO为进位输出端,当1001后输出低电平;BO为借位输出端,当0000后输出低电平;D3D2D1D0为数据预置端;Q3Q2Q1Q0为数据输出端。倒计时器初始状态为01100000,当输入一个脉冲,计时器就会减一。低位的状态是0000时,再来一个脉冲,BO端就会由1—〉0,这是高位的CPD端由0—〉1。高位因得到一个上升沿,从而触发,进行减1运算。低位的状态变为1001。当高低位的状态都为0000时,它们的LD端就会接低电平,从而进行异步置数。计时器状态变为01100000。秒脉冲再来就会重复以上操作。
>=1CPUCPDCRQ3Q2Q1Q074LS192D3D21D11D0-CO-BO-LD.CPUCPDCRQ3Q2Q1Q074LS192D3D2D1D0-CO-BO-LD1CP图2-12
2.3 时间显示器
时间显示器由两片七段显示译码器74LS48和两片半导体数码管构成。其组成如图3—1(a)所示,74LS48的外引线排列如图3—1(b)所示。A3A2A1A0组成8421BCA码为输入端,Ya~Yg为输出端。LT、RBI、BI/RBO为使能控制端,
都是低有效。LT为灯测试输入端,RBI为灭零输入端,BI/RBO为灭灯输入/灭零输出端。此半导体数码管为带小数点(DP)的七段数码管,分为共阴和共阳型。
共阴型数码管的COM端接低电平,共阳型的则接高电平。
7
d e com f gafgbd e com f gedcDpd e com f gafgbd e com f gedcDpa b com c Dpa b com c DpYa Yb Yc Yd Ye Yf Yg74LS48(十位)A3 A2 A1 A0 LT RBI BI/RBD(a)图 3-1Ya Yb Yc Yd Ye Yf Yg74LS48(个位)A3 A2 A1 A0 LT RBI BI/RBD
A1A2LTBI/RBORBIA3A0GND123161514131211109VccYfYgYaYbYcYdYe2.4 定时器 状态控制器
定时器由倒计时器、两个与门、两个与非门和一个或非门构成。逻辑门所构成的电路如图4—1所示。状态控制器有两个JK触发器级联而成,如图5—1所示。状态控制器实质是一个2位二进制异步加法计数器,下降沿触发。当倒计时器的状态为01100000(60)或00000101(5)时,定时器输出0,其余状态都是是输出1。倒计时器的初状态为01100000,即定时器的初态为0,倒计到00000101之前定时器的输出都为1,当到00000101时,定时器输出为0。状态控制器得到下降沿而触发。状态控制器到下一个01100000时再次触发。同时状态跟随转变。这就实现了状态首先隔55秒转换一次,接着隔5秒转换一次,然后再隔55秒转换。如此循环就可以实现定时信号转换的目标。
74LS4845678(b)
8
定时器&>=&&&图4-1
2.5 信号灯显示
此部分由一个数据分配器74LS138、两个与门和6个发光二极管构成。其结构如图6—1(a)所示。74LS138的外引线排列如图6—1 (b)所示,其中A2A1A0是3个二进制代码输入端;Y7Y0是8个输出端,低电平有效;STA、STB、STC是使能控制端。当STA=1且STB=STC=0时,分配器才工作。制造二极管的材料不同就会发出不同的光。
&&STBSTCSTY7GNDAA0A1A211621531441374LS13851261171098Y0Y1Y2Y374LS138Y4Y5Y6Y7UccY0Y1Y2Y3Y4Y5Y6
A2A1A0STASTBSTC1 9
2.6总电路设计
10
3 元器件清单
元件名称 74LS192计数器 JK触发器 个数 2 2 1 2 6 2 1 NE555定时器 七段LED数码管 发光二极管LED 74LS48 74LS138译码器
参考文献
[1] 陈晰. 数字电路试验技术基础.北京:电子工业出版社,1999 [2] 李元. 数字电路与逻辑设计.南京:南京大学出版社,1997 [4] 郭斌. 数字逻辑电路.北京:电子科技大学出版社,1995
[5] 程震先. 数字电路实验与应用.北京:北京理工大学出版社,1999
11
因篇幅问题不能全部显示,请点此查看更多更全内容